The Last Picture Show (1971) — Screenplay

In a fading 1950s Texas town, restless teen Sonny seeks meaning and connection as the local cinema closes, forcing him to confront adulthood's harsh truths.

Written by
Larry McMurtry, Peter Bogdanovich
Genre
Drama
Length
120 pages

Study this script for its masterful evocation of small-town ennui through precise, observational detail and its quiet, cumulative character arcs. The dialogue feels naturalistic yet loaded, while the structure mirrors the town's slow decline, offering a lesson in building atmosphere and emotional resonance without melodrama.
